Compound Overview
AHK-CU is a synthetic copper tripeptide variant used in cosmetic and dermal-cell research. The source data defines the compound as a copper-binding tripeptide built around the AHK sequence, displayed as Ala-His-Lys + Cu2+. Within that supplied framework, AHK-CU is relevant to controlled laboratory workflows that compare copper-binding peptide behavior, especially against GHK-Cu.
The provided structural description identifies AHK-CU as an Ala-His-Lys copper(II) complex and notes that it is commonly identified as Copper Tripeptide-3. This page uses those descriptors only as compound-identity and research-context language. They are not presented as cosmetic-use instructions, topical-use guidance, human-use claims, veterinary-use claims, or therapeutic claims.
Because the AHK-CU source record flags identifier variability across vendor references, researchers should treat the exact form as documentation-dependent. The supplied warning specifically notes that AHK-CU identifiers should be verified against current lot documentation to confirm whether the vial is supplied as free peptide, copper complex, acetate salt, or another counter-ion form.

Storage, Handling & Stability Guidelines
The provided storage guidance is to store lyophilized AHK-CU at -20°C, desiccated and protected from light. After reconstitution, the source data directs laboratories to aliquot the material and avoid repeated freeze-thaw cycles.
- Store sealed lyophilized AHK-CU at -20°C.
- Keep lyophilized material desiccated.
- Protect the compound from light during storage and handling.
- After reconstitution, separate material into aliquots when compatible with the research workflow.
- Avoid repeated freeze-thaw cycles after reconstitution.
The supplied AHK-CU record does not specify a reconstitution solvent, working concentration, post-reconstitution expiration interval, or formal stability-study data. Those details should be established only from current lot documentation or a laboratory-validated protocol, not inferred from this product description.
